Ingredients You'll Need
Before you start, gather up these simple ingredients: Before you start, gather up these simple ingredients:
1 and 2/3 cup all-purpose flour
2 tbsps of granulated sugar(organic)
1 teaspoon of baking powder
1/2 of a teaspoon of ba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 cup buttermilk (or 1 cup mixture of 1 tablespoon vinegar or lemon juice with milk)
1 large egg
2 tablespoons melted butter or oil
More butter or any oil for frying or whatever you want.
Optional: I may replace vanilla extract with cinnamon extract or use ground nutmeg.

Tips for Perfect Pancakes
Now that you have the basic steps down let's dive into some tips to ensure your pancakes turn out perfectly every time:
Don't Overmix the Batter: Creating a wet and dry mix is crucial. Do not overmix, as this will result in a "flat" cake. There will be just a few lumps in the dough, but they are well worth it!
Use a 'Hot Griddle' or Pan: This is the crucial element that will make the pancake cook equally and properly. They should be crispy on the outside and soft inside with just a little taste of the sweetness. The pan or griddle must also be heated before the batter is placed onto it. This leads to a faster and more even cooking process, contrasting it with the case where the pancakes can end up either soggy or inadequately cooked.
Let the Batter Rest: While waiting will surely torture some individuals who cannot resist the temptation to eat, the batter needs to rest a few minutes before cooking to obtain fluffy and delightfully light pancakes. The brief interruption gives the gluten in the flour a chance to relax, and that does wonders to make the pancakes airier but still firm.
Flip Your Pancakes Only Once
Avoid the urge to flip your pancakes constantly. Wait for bubbles to form and the edges to set before flipping.
